## Further Reading

So you've got your plugin publishing events into Schemavault — nice. Before you go wild with custom payloads, it's worth understanding how compatibility checks work, because the registry will happily reject anything that breaks downstream consumers. The short version: additive changes are fine, renames are not, and versioning is your friend. We've written up the full compatibility matrix, plus examples of common mistakes plugin authors make (and how to avoid them), on our internal docs page here.

dashboard of tawef-hagug = https://superset.norvadyn.local/display/projects/build/ticket/build/spaces/ticket/1e989f0e6c200d20fc4ae06b

Minutes — Management Meeting, Harwick Supplies

Present: sales leads, ops.

Training budget for next year agreed at a 12% uplift. Priority: negotiation skills and the Pellar CRM rollout. External providers to be shortlisted by month-end. Unused allocations will not roll over. Leads to submit headcount-based requests within two weeks. One restricted item was noted and is set out below.

confidential, kajof-tahof: The pricing group signed off on a budget of $491.8 million for Project Casvan.

### Changelog — Quillprint v2.4.1

Heads up, reviewers: we renamed `PDF_RENDER_KEY` to `QUILLPRINT_RENDER_SECRET` because the old name kept colliding with the thumbnailer's config in shared environments. The invoice renderer now refuses to boot if the legacy name is set, so update your local env files before pulling. Migration is a one-liner — just rename it. For local dev, add the following line:

sealed setting: ARCHIVE_KEY3=8d0

## Marketing Budget Reduction — Restricted

Heads of department: the marketing budget is reduced by 18% effective next quarter. The Silverquill campaign continues; the Harrowgate sponsorship and two regional events are cancelled. Headcount is unaffected for now. Performance channels keep funding; brand spend absorbs most of the cut. Reallocation requests go through Prenn's office with a one-page justification. The reduction funds a priority described in the confidential note below.

internal memo for hahif-hahaf: Headcount on the Zorwyn team goes from 9 to 100 by the end of October. Gross margin on Zorwyn came in at 5 percent against a plan of 10 percent.